Carmelite House 50 Victoria Embankment London EC4Y 0DZ
Carmelite House 50 Victoria Embankment London England EC4Y 0DZ
SION HALL 56 VICTORIA EMBANKMENT LONDON EC4Y 0DZ
SION HALL 56 VICTORIA EMBANKMENT LONDON LONDON EC4Y 0DZ
All company pages are publicly accessible
Share on social media